Virtual Commerce
An umbrella term covering a host of tools and strategies to boost sales and create immersive, digital shopping experiences across digital channels.
Live Commerce
Also known as “Live Shopping”, this technology allows businesses to live stream to a broad audience while making the experience shoppable. The option to purchase directly in-stream combined with real-time interactions with hosts and chat, elevates regular video content to a commercially powerful tool.
Shoppable Video
Shoppable Video is similar to Live Commerce in the sense that it allows viewers to shop directly from the video itself, but without being contingent on being live. This opens up a host of possibilities for repurposing existing content, bite-sizing Live Shopping shows or even creating dedicated shoppable content.
Shoppable Video is usually used in place of a traditional asset, showcasing a product in more detail and giving inspiration on how to style or utilize an item. It enriches PDPs and brings e-coms to life.
Shoppable Images
Like Shoppable Video, Shoppable Images allow customers to add to cart and check out directly from still image content. The beauty of Shoppable Images is that they are easily implemented across any website, as many e-commerce sites still rely heavily on pictures to showcase products, advertise and create beautiful designs.

Digital Clienteling
Digital Clienteling is the ultimate of providing the same personal service shoppers know and love from physical stores on digital.
Through video calls, sales agents help guide consumers to the right products, offering expert guidance during the call. Co-browsing allows for product displaying and the agent can even help the customer check out.
This technology is especially popular with luxury brands and retailers selling high ticket items.
Virtual Try-On
A technology, powered by Augmented Reality (AR), allowing consumers to “try on” or visualize products. This technology creates a fully immersive shopping experience, enabling customers to browse virtual stores and attend events in addition to the product visualization.

Chat
Chat technology is nothing new, but recently, brands have evolved to use it as a sales- and customer service tool. Especially combined with AI, Chat provides a quick and convenient way for consumers to connect with brands, which can funnel into customer care or sales as you’d like.
